From mboxrd@z Thu Jan 1 00:00:00 1970 From: Thomas De Schampheleire Date: Mon, 7 Dec 2020 11:04:39 +0100 Subject: [Buildroot] [PATCH 2/3] package/perl-devel-size: new package In-Reply-To: <20201207100443.13727-1-patrickdepinguin@gmail.com> References: <20201207100443.13727-1-patrickdepinguin@gmail.com> Message-ID: <20201207100443.13727-2-patrickdepinguin@gmail.com> List-Id: MIME-Version: 1.0 Content-Type: text/plain; charset="us-ascii" Content-Transfer-Encoding: 7bit To: buildroot@busybox.net From: Joeri Barbarien Signed-off-by: Joeri Barbarien Signed-off-by: Thomas De Schampheleire --- DEVELOPERS | 1 + package/Config.in | 1 + package/perl-devel-size/Config.in | 11 +++++++++++ package/perl-devel-size/perl-devel-size.hash | 6 ++++++ package/perl-devel-size/perl-devel-size.mk | 14 ++++++++++++++ 5 files changed, 33 insertions(+) create mode 100644 package/perl-devel-size/Config.in create mode 100644 package/perl-devel-size/perl-devel-size.hash create mode 100644 package/perl-devel-size/perl-devel-size.mk diff --git a/DEVELOPERS b/DEVELOPERS index 6cd52c07c5..fceea601ed 100644 --- a/DEVELOPERS +++ b/DEVELOPERS @@ -2510,6 +2510,7 @@ F: package/perl-crypt-blowfish/ F: package/perl-crypt-cbc/ F: package/perl-crypt-openssl-aes/ F: package/perl-devel-cycle/ +F: package/perl-devel-size/ F: package/perl-i18n/ F: package/perl-locale-maketext-lexicon/ F: package/perl-lwp-protocol-https/ diff --git a/package/Config.in b/package/Config.in index 9eddd3ec01..7f3ffc6093 100644 --- a/package/Config.in +++ b/package/Config.in @@ -741,6 +741,7 @@ menu "Perl libraries/modules" source "package/perl-dbi/Config.in" source "package/perl-devel-cycle/Config.in" source "package/perl-devel-globaldestruction/Config.in" + source "package/perl-devel-size/Config.in" source "package/perl-devel-stacktrace/Config.in" source "package/perl-devel-stacktrace-ashtml/Config.in" source "package/perl-device-serialport/Config.in" diff --git a/package/perl-devel-size/Config.in b/package/perl-devel-size/Config.in new file mode 100644 index 0000000000..b545cf1844 --- /dev/null +++ b/package/perl-devel-size/Config.in @@ -0,0 +1,11 @@ +config BR2_PACKAGE_PERL_DEVEL_SIZE + bool "perl-devel-size" + depends on !BR2_STATIC_LIBS + help + Perl extension for finding the memory usage of Perl + variables. + + https://metacpan.org/release/Devel-Size + +comment "perl-devel-size needs a toolchain w/ dynamic library" + depends on BR2_STATIC_LIBS diff --git a/package/perl-devel-size/perl-devel-size.hash b/package/perl-devel-size/perl-devel-size.hash new file mode 100644 index 0000000000..c0fbcf29c5 --- /dev/null +++ b/package/perl-devel-size/perl-devel-size.hash @@ -0,0 +1,6 @@ +# retrieved by scancpan from http://cpan.metacpan.org/ +md5 0b5335d69402c75d5ab9978027ae2f66 Devel-Size-0.83.tar.gz +sha256 757a67e0aa59ae103ea5ca092cbecc025644ebdc326731688ffab6f8823ef4b3 Devel-Size-0.83.tar.gz + +# computed by scancpan +sha256 fca4ebe3a1f329aa33a4d259c0a5b136a15a40b987c60c2dd6f1007bb01a1513 README diff --git a/package/perl-devel-size/perl-devel-size.mk b/package/perl-devel-size/perl-devel-size.mk new file mode 100644 index 0000000000..9acc67c9ea --- /dev/null +++ b/package/perl-devel-size/perl-devel-size.mk @@ -0,0 +1,14 @@ +################################################################################ +# +# perl-devel-size +# +################################################################################ + +PERL_DEVEL_SIZE_VERSION = 0.83 +PERL_DEVEL_SIZE_SOURCE = Devel-Size-$(PERL_DEVEL_SIZE_VERSION).tar.gz +PERL_DEVEL_SIZE_SITE = $(BR2_CPAN_MIRROR)/authors/id/N/NW/NWCLARK +PERL_DEVEL_SIZE_LICENSE = Artistic or GPL-1.0+ +PERL_DEVEL_SIZE_LICENSE_FILES = README +PERL_DEVEL_SIZE_DISTNAME = Devel-Size + +$(eval $(perl-package)) -- 2.26.2